Kumar D.J., 36, is an independent candidate contesting from the Thalli Assembly constituency in Tamil Nadu. With a 5th standard education, he works in construction and has declared assets of Rs. 22.57 lakhs, all in movable assets with no immovable property. His financial profile is modest and consistent with his stated profession as a construction worker, with no liabilities declared.
